Hanuman Movie : First Day Box Office Collection

Hanuman movie featuring the protagonist Teja Sajja is receiving a lot of love worldwide as it’s available in different languages like Hindi, English, Tamil, Telugu, Kannada, Malayalam, Chinese, Spanish, Korean.

Now talking about its first-day collection Hanuman movie, according to the report earned ₹ 7.56 crores net in India on its first day in different languages according to the early estimates. Now talking about its earnings in different languages so, the movie earned an amount of ₹ 5.50 crore net from the Telugu and ₹2 crores net from Hindi language.
